What is what is a German Shepherd?

German Shepherds are smart active dogs that require plenty of exercise to stay healthy and happy. They are loyal, protective, and excel at obedience training. These intelligent dogs are excellent service dogs for police and military. They thrive in homes that can give them lots of physical and mental exercise every day, which includes long walks or runs as well as regular trips to interesting places to explore. If they’re not exercised enough German Shepherds can exhibit undesirable behaviors such as excessive barking and chewing.

Despite their intelligence and trainability, German Shepherds can be somewhat standoffish around strangers. They have a strong urge to protect the ones they love and are often aloof or shy with people they don’t know. However, once they become a part of a relationship they are extremely trustworthy and loyal. These dogs make great guards and watchdogs if they are properly socialised and trained from a young age.

It is crucial to select the right German Shepherd from a reputable breeder. Organizations like the American Kennel Club have search tools that can help you locate a breeder near you. Beware of puppy mills, as they may sell sick or unhealthy animals.

Many German Shepherds suffer from genetic problems due to poor breeding practices. One such issue is elbow and hip dysplasia. The large ears of this breed are susceptible to infections. They are also susceptible to of bloating due their large body.

Heart disease, which includes dilated cardiomyopathy, valvular diseases deafness, blindness and deafness along with other disorders of vision can affect German Shepherds. It is essential to take your dog for regular veterinary exams which includes listening to the heart with a stethoscope and taking x-rays of the chest.

Origins

German Shepherds are a breed that has been around for a number of years. They were employed as working dogs and herding dogs by the German army. The breed’s intelligence and striking appearance caught the attention of military leaders and commanders, including Adolph Hitler. During World War I, the GSD was a key part of the German army and its use in combat helped to bring it to international acclaim. Stories of these loyal and intelligent war dogs were brought back to the United States by returning soldiers which helped make the German Shepherd Dog one of the most sought-after breeds of dogs in America. The GSD also gained popularity in films and films, with such as Rin-Tin-Tin and Strongheart using variations of the “boy and his dog” theme. However the American breed has its own unique features that differ from German Shepherds in Europe. These differences are due to the fact that the American German Shepherd is bred to different standards than its European counterpart.

The background of the German Shepherd can be traced back to the late 19th century when Captain Max Emil Friedrich von Stephanitz was a key player in its creation. The former cavalry officer and student at Berlin Veterinary College wanted to create a herding dog that was both strong and intelligent. In 1899, he found the dog he was looking for at a show for dogs. It was named Hektor Linksrhein and possessed all the traits he wanted. He purchased the dog and changed its name to Horand von Grafrath and founded the Society for German Shepherd Dogs (Verein for German Schaferhunde). Horand was the first German Shepherd, fathered many puppies that were inbred to ensure the sameness of his breed.

In 1908, the German Shepherd Dog was recognized by the breed registry as a distinct breed of dog. It was employed as a herder, police dog, courier, sentry and personal dog. The German Shepherd was a popular companion for Nazi soldiers because of its obedience. Its role in Nazi propaganda campaigns also made many Americans and allies against the breed. The GSD recovered and is now one the most popular breeds around the world.

Characteristics

German Shepherd Dogs have a wide range of uses including herding, search and rescue, to other tasks. They are a breed unbeatable in terms of intelligence, schäferhunde suchen Ein zuhause athleticism, and versatility. This strong and sturdy canine is now one of the most sought-after pets in America. The German Shepherd Dog is an excellent pet for families and can get along with children and other dogs when they are raised with them, although they are likely to be protective of their family members and their property. They are generally wary of strangers and will bark if their owners are in danger, or if they see someone approaching their home.

German Shepherd Dogs need daily vigorous exercise due to their work history. This can be met with long walks, active play sessions, and other activities that test their bodies and minds. If not adequately stimulated, they can become destructive, so it is best to provide them with enough physical and mental stimulation to keep them happy and occupied. They would be at home in homes with a backyard where they can run and play, but they are not suitable for living in apartments.

Like many large bodied breeds such as the German Shepherd Dog is prone to elbow dysplasia and hip dysplasia. This condition can cause arthritis and pain later on in life. They are also prone bloat and should eat low-fat diets.

Apart from these issues Apart from these, the German Shepherd is an intelligent and active breed that can be an ideal companion. They are easy to train and they enjoy learning tricks, participating in exciting activities and spending time with family. The ear that is erect should be cleaned and washed every week. The nails should be cut every three to four weeks. A good coat brush should be regularly used to help eliminate dead hair and keep the coat in good condition.

Training

German Shepherds are energetic dogs that require plenty of physical and mental exercise. If they aren’t given a way to release their energy they could be destructive or even find their own jobs. Dog trainers employ various methods to teach German Shepherd pups obedience and other abilities. These techniques help them gain the confidence and focus they need to succeed as working dogs or family pets.

Traditionally German Shepherds are utilized for herding livestock and patrolling the edges of fields to guard against trespassing and damage to crops. They are also used as security dogs by military and police departments around the world. They are suited to many different tasks and are highly clever. The ability to herd and the strength make this breed a great herder, and their ability to be obedient and train police officers makes them a great working dog.

The German Shepherd’s pet lines tend to be less energy and intensity than show-ring strains that are used in herding competitions. However, they’re still high-energy dogs that need to have lots of physical and mental exercise every day. If they don’t, they’ll look for ways to get their energy back, which may include chewing things up or yelling at children.

While physical exercises are important, it is important that a German Shepherd puppy should learn to be able to follow commands. Using commands to calm them down is more effective than the active games that could make dogs excited rather than calm it down.

The German Shepherd is an adaptable breed that gets along well with people and animals of all kinds. They are also relatively easy to train and are generally willing to follow the instructions of their owners. They’re also extremely protective of their owners and will defend them against strangers when needed.

German Shepherds are at risk of certain health issues, such as hip dysplasia and elbow dysplasia. Heart problems such as heart valve problems or murmurs and an enlarged heart are also common. Other health conditions that are common to people include exocrine pancreatic insufficiency as well as Von Willebrand disease, a genetic bleeding disorder. These conditions can be controlled with medication and proper care.
